Vintage Indigo Sashiko Cotton Furoshiki
A three-panel indigo dyed furoshiki from the early 20th century. This piece features traditional reinforced sashiko stitching on the corners with three distinct designs: Shippou-tsunagi (overlapping circles), sayagata (interlocking manji, an ancient Buddhist symbol), and folding fans.
It is in good condition for its age, with some small holes and a couple of mends.
